Herb-Infused Low-Sodium Tomato Soup
A velvety tomato soup bursting with fresh herbs and minimal sodium, perfect for a comforting yet healthy meal. Ingredients
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 medium, diced onion
- 2 cloves, minced garlic
- 2 (14.5 oz) cans, no salt added diced tomatoes
- 2 cups, low-sodium vegetable broth
- 1 tsp dried oregano
- 1 tsp dried thyme
- 1/4 cup, chopped fresh basil
- 1/4 tsp black pepper
Instructions
- Step 1: Heat 2 tbsp ol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add 1 medium diced onion and cook for 5 minutes until translucent and softened.
- Step 2: Add 2 cloves minced garlic and cook for 1 minute until fragrant, stirring constantly to prevent burning.
- Step 3: Stir in 2 (14.5 oz) cans diced tomatoes (no salt added), 2 cups low-sodium vegetable broth, 1 tsp dried oregano, 1 tsp dried thyme, and 1/4 tsp black pepper. Bring to a gentle simmer and cook uncovered for 20 minutes.
- Step 4: Remove from heat and stir in 1/4 cup fresh basil. Blend with an immersion blender until completely smooth.
- Step 5: Return to low heat and simmer for 5 minutes more. Adjust seasoning with extra black pepper if needed.

How do I store leftover Herb-Infused Low-Sodium Tomato Soup?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ep olive oil from drying out.
